Transaction 23f6e358d590d37312776296120abcd5ec12140ed8b0af64cc5e13aed355a678
4 Input
2 Outputs
- 23f6e358d590d37312776296120abcd5ec12140ed8b0af64cc5e13aed355a678:0
- 23f6e358d590d37312776296120abcd5ec12140ed8b0af64cc5e13aed355a678:1
value 1254145
address 141p75GJTqgaCyPjdfrZ4TuLKATzgjBedP
value 1384672
address 3BMEXfVpjX99AK59Ca98fw5mgHhL1NvtQ9